President-elect, Tinubu has a proven track record of performance – Rukevwe Ugwumba
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terShare on LinkedinShare on Whatsapp

A prominent chieftain of the All Progressives Congress, APC, Prof Rukevwe Ugwumba (Nee Akpedeye) has said that the President-elect of Nigeria, Ahmed Bola Tinubu, is one who has a proven track record of performance needed at this critical stage of the political reengineering of the country.

On Wednesday morning, the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) declared the former Lagos State governor as the winner of the Saturday, February 25, 2023, presidential election on the banner of the APC with total votes of 8,794,726.

Ugwumba, a Canadian-based medical practitioner, philanthropist, and politician, who hails from Uwheru community of Ughelli North Local Government Area of Delta State in a congratulatory message on the emergence of Bola Tinubu as the sixteen President of Nigeria said, the Jagaban has his popular called has come with a message of ‘Renewed Hope’ for the country in dire need of transformation and national unity.

The professor of medicine and family health said, “The emergence of Bola Tinubu is a new dawn in Nigeria. I congratulate the President-elect and the Vice President-elect, Senator Kashim Shettima on their victory in the just concluded presidential election.

“For me and millions of Nigerians who came out en masse last Saturday to cast our votes for the Tinubu-Shettima presidential ticket, the INEC declared results and the victory that followed reflected the wishes of Nigerians across the country.

“We cherish the victory and we are confident that the President-elect, Bola Tinubu has the competence, capacity, pedigree, a vast wealth of experience, mental and physical sagacity to right the wrongs of our dear country.”

Prof Ugwumba, a member of the Tinubu-Shettima Presidential Campaign Council and Deputy Director of Health, Delta APC Campaign Council, therefore, called on all Nigerians irrespective of political divides to rally support for the incoming administration of Bola Tinubu, who has a deep sense of commitment and loyalty to develop the country to the envy of the outside world.

“Renowned and credible international election observer groups that monitored the Saturday, February 25, 2023, presidential election have attested to and given a pass mark to the conduct and outcome of the election.

“Unnecessary litigation is not what we need now. Bola Tinubu has the antidote for the myriad of problems plaguing the Nigerian state. We will surely rejoice and celebrate that indeed the light has come,” said Prof Ugwumba.
